Description
Millennial-year production at the Philadelphia Mint yielded this inaugural spiked head variety for the 2000-P Lincoln Memorial Cent, documented by Cuds on Coins on February 16, 2017. The turn of the millennium was marked by heightened collector interest in all aspects of coinage bearing the year 2000 date, yet the 2000-P spiked head catalog has remained small, with this -01 entry standing as one of very few documented examples. The Philadelphia Mint's cent production in 2000 was substantial — billions of coins requiring hundreds of die pairs — yet the modest spiked head count may reflect a lack of focused searching rather than an absence of varieties. Die clashes on Memorial Cents produce their characteristic spike through a well-understood mechanism: the press cycles without a planchet, the Lincoln Memorial reverse contacts the obverse die, and the Memorial's columns and detailed architecture transfer into the die face. Subsequent coins display a raised spike on Lincoln's portrait whose position and angle identify the specific die pair involved. As the first documented spiked head for the 2000-P, this variety serves as the anchor point for the date's catalog and the only confirmed evidence that at least one die pair from that year's production experienced a clash event. The early 2017 documentation date places this discovery during the formative years of systematic Memorial Cent spiked head research, when the Cuds on Coins database was actively expanding its coverage across all dates. Collectors who undertake focused searching of 2000-P cent inventories may well discover additional spiked heads that would expand this currently minimal catalog.
